Astelia grandis, commonly known as swamp Astelia, is a plant species in the family Asteliaceae. It is native to the North and South Islands of New Zealand.

Description

Astelia grandis is a member of the genus Astelia within the family Asteliaceae. This species is found in the North and South Islands of New Zealand. It was first described by Hook.f. ex Kirk and has been recognized in botanical literature since 1968. The plant is known by the common name 'swamp Astelia' in English.
